WebDec 10, 2024 · In the first stage, ice crystals form around the outside of cell walls. Water is lost from the cell’s interior and dehydration causes cell death. Upon rewarming, the blood flows through veins also injured by the cold. Holes appear in vessel walls and blood leaks out into the tissues. WebStages of frostbite. Skin without cold damage (1) has no change in color or texture. Frostnip (2) is mild frostbite that irritates the skin, causing a change in skin color and a cold feeling followed by numbness. Superficial frostbite The second stage of frostbite causes reddened skin to become pale and hard to the touch. etude any cushion light beigeWebMar 26, 2024 · Frostbite occurs when the tissues are exposed to temperatures below their freezing point. Ice crystal formation (intracellular and extracellular) causes cell dehydration and shrinkage, electrolyte disturbances, lipid and protein denaturation and resultant cell injury and death.
